Включение бинаря в РЕ

Discussion in 'WASM.BEGINNERS' started by Gonzzik, Aug 3, 2007.

  1. Gonzzik

    Gonzzik New Member

    Blog Posts:
    0
    Joined:
    Mar 8, 2007
    Messages:
    61
    Скажите, можно ли VС++ включить в выходной ехе бинарный файл как это делает компилятор фасма.
    Типа:
    file "1.bin"

    чтоб не писать его вручную ../%FC/%..
     
  2. xh4ck

    xh4ck New Member

    Blog Posts:
    0
    Joined:
    Mar 6, 2005
    Messages:
    60
    Location:
    Russia
    в ресурсы не проще будет запихать?
     
  3. Gonzzik

    Gonzzik New Member

    Blog Posts:
    0
    Joined:
    Mar 8, 2007
    Messages:
    61
    нет. надо именно в массив.
     
  4. censored

    censored New Member

    Blog Posts:
    0
    Joined:
    Jul 5, 2005
    Messages:
    1,615
    Location:
    деревня "Анонимные Прокси"
    нельзя
     
  5. Quantum

    Quantum Паладин дзена

    Blog Posts:
    0
    Joined:
    Jan 6, 2003
    Messages:
    3,143
    Location:
    Ukraine
    Средстцами утиля типа bin2db.

    Либо собрать обьектник фасмом.
     
  6. Ustus

    Ustus New Member

    Blog Posts:
    0
    Joined:
    Aug 8, 2005
    Messages:
    834
    Location:
    Харьков
    Gonzzik
    Можешь извратнуться как я :) - компилишь fasm'ом в MS COFF и пришиваешь объектник в проект as is.

    :dntknw: опередили... :):):)
     
  7. roman_pro

    roman_pro New Member

    Blog Posts:
    0
    Joined:
    Feb 9, 2007
    Messages:
    291
    В WinHex'е открываешь бинарь, Edit->Copy All->C source и получаешь в буфере обмена готовый для вставки в проект код:

    Code (Text):
    1. unsigned char data[532] = {
    2.     0x06, 0x02, 0x00, 0x00, 0x00, 0x24, 0x00, 0x00, 0x52, 0x53, 0x41, 0x31, 0x00....
    3.            };
     
  8. Gonzzik

    Gonzzik New Member

    Blog Posts:
    0
    Joined:
    Mar 8, 2007
    Messages:
    61
    нет. мне это не подходит. ну все равно спасибо.
     
  9. Asterix

    Asterix New Member

    Blog Posts:
    0
    Joined:
    Feb 25, 2003
    Messages:
    3,576
    грузишь дистриб ufmod и юзаешь утилиту eff, она конвертит в несколько форматов,
    в том числе masm и C